# A student is trying to separate two miscible liquids collected from a chemical reaction — ethanol and water. Explain how fractional distillation could be used to separate these two liquids.

> OCR GCSE Chemistry A: Gateway Science (J248) — C2.1 Purity and separating mixtures · Explain · 4 marks

> Ethanol boils at 78 °C and water boils at 100 °C. When mixed together, ethanol and water form a mixture that cannot be separated by simple distillation alone.

## Mark scheme (4 marks)

1. The mixture is heated in a fractionating column
2. Ethanol has a lower boiling point so it evaporates / vaporises first
3. The two liquids are collected as separate fractions because they have different boiling points
4. The vapour is cooled / condensed to collect each liquid
